description Bartle, Bernard and Bartle, Joan. Interview about living in Grand Falls and working for the AND Company as a tinsmith. They discuss Bernard Bartle’s father’s work, moving to and growing up in the community, staff houses, Bernard’s work with A.N.D. Co., setting up his own business, Bernard and Joan’s meeting and marriage, entertainment, clubs, hospitals, churches, and businesses in the community, the difference between Grand Falls and Windsor, and the I.W.A. Strike.
